Output 35d3d18000de5444627c8e91ba28d685de7720f67900701c86c210e9ce56aa05:7

value
4398804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21bb32499d14c448825b3991df2984819e8f157 OP_EQUAL
address
3PmAdaefWbaaFTmp4giZ8sYHb3uicgJsy8
transaction
35d3d18000de5444627c8e91ba28d685de7720f67900701c86c210e9ce56aa05
spent
true